You would think The Rolling Stones would cover this song more often, right?

Actually, if we're going down that road, they should be covering "Rollin' Stone" by Muddy Waters, the song that inspired their name. But no, it's the Bob Dylan staple they brushed off earlier this month at the Denver stop of their No Filter tour. Fun fact: the band has indeed covered the song before, but this is the first time they've covered it on this North American tour. Take a look.
